sp_iqstatus;
sp_iqversionuse;
重点查看:
设备大小;
动态内存;
active txn versions
集群:
1、操作系统要一样
2、并发查询的能力可以水平线性扩展;
3、单机时,并发1秒以上的查询,到四五十的同时查询时,性能就会急剧下降。
其中一个辅助接点是作为协调节点的备份节点。
增加接点,需要有IQ许可证(cpu许可),还需要加一个mutiplex的server许可。
启动单节点IQ:
start_iq @params.cfg -n mpxnode_c -x "tcpip{host=host1;port=2763}"
-n名字一般在命令行指定。
hostname
server
database path
path to iq main &temp
dbisql -c "uid=DBA;pwd=sql;eng=mpxnode_c"
主节点:
start_iq @params.cfg -n t2 t2.db
create multiplex server mpxnode_w1 DATABASE ‘host2\\mpx\\mpxtest.db‘ HOST ‘host2‘s ip‘ PORT 2957 ROLE WRITER STATUS INCLUDED
路径要存在
从节点需要配置:
host
port
IQ软件
不需要建库
db/.log/IQ/store 路径
完成之后,进到从节点路径:
dbbackup -c "uid=DBA;pwd=sql;eng=t2;" -d -y .
>dbbackup -c "uid=DBA;pwd=sql;eng=mpx_n1;links=tcpip{port=2765}" -d -y .
>dblog -r -t mpx_n1.log mpx_n1.db
>start_iq -n mpx_sec -x "tcpip{port=2689}" @params.cfg mpx_n1.db
连接到节点
dbisql -c "" -x "tcpip{}"
alter tablespace IQ_SYSTEM_TEMP add FILE mpx_node_temp ‘temp_file.iqtmp‘ size 100
sp_iqmpxinfo 查看主从接口信息。
dblog
IQ里边的数据挖掘函数等等,需要另外收费。
文本的扫描、自定义函数,是可以实现的。
虚拟备份。